Iran crowned champion at Tokyo 2025 Deaflympics

The Iranian freestyle and Greco-Roman wrestling teams have claimed the championship titles at the 25th Summer Deaflympics 2025 in Tokyo, Japan.

Iran’s freestyle wrestling team achieved remarkable success at the sporting event, winning the championship title with a total of five medals, including one gold, three silver, and one bronze.

Mohammad Siyahoushi claimed the gold medal in the 57 kg weight category. Silver medals were awarded to Keivan Rostamabadi (65 kg), Abolfazl Zohrevand (74 kg), and Mohammad Ghamarpour (125 kg). Additionally, Erfan Sattari earned a bronze medal in the 97 kg category.

In Greco-Roman wrestling, Iranian athletes also performed exceptionally well, securing two gold medals, one silver, and three bronze medals.

Gold medals were won by Meisam Dezfouli (87 kg) and Abouzar Rabizadeh (97 kg). Mehdi Bakhshi took home a silver medal in the 97 kg weight category. The bronze medals were awarded to Abolfazl Abolvafaei (60 kg), Mohammad Zeratpisheh (77 kg), and Mohammadreza Shabani (130 kg).

As a result, Iran’s Greco-Roman and freestyle wrestling teams won the team championship titles with a total of 6 and 5 medals, respectively.

Over 3,000 athletes from more than 70 countries are competing for medals in 21 sports.

The 25th edition of the Deaflympics is being held in Tokyo, Japan, from November 15 to 26, 2025.

This edition commemorates 101 years since the inaugural Summer Deaflympics, which took place in Paris in 1924. In the previous edition held in Caxias do Sul, Brazil, Ukraine topped the medal table, followed by the USA and the Republic of Korea in second and third place, respectively.
